    <title>Appearance by authorised representative.</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/acts?id=23955</link>
    <description>Any person entitled or required to appear before a GST officer, Appellate Authority, or Appellate Tribunal may, except where personal appearance on oath or affirmation is required, appear through an authorised representative. The term includes relatives, regular employees, advocates, practising chartered accountants, cost accountants, company secretaries, certain retired tax officers subject to a one-year cooling-off period, and authorised GST practitioners. The section also bars persons dismissed from service, convicted of specified offences, found guilty of misconduct, or adjudged insolvent from representing others, with corresponding permanent or temporary disqualifications.</description>
